“…Some Industry 4.0 tools like IoTs, Big data analytics, Blockchain, and web services support the adoption of PLM (Ghode et al, 2023). The application of IoT along with PLM would capitalize on this formerly unexploited area of improvements, like IoT allowing the collection and use of real-life product operating conditions data, mitigating the disconnection between real-life conditions and design specifications (Tchoffa et al, 2021). The data generated by this means is very high in terms of volume, variety, and rate, so, the use of big data analytics is vital to handle it (Lim et al, 2020;Holligan et al, 2017).…”
